Output 336be4e4bf83902df2987846476e0453dfae0f37b91cebf0eca97c4b95027f56:1

value
10633989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 143aeb077ded94f62052a3d68619982848f63407 OP_EQUAL
address
33Xz25dCCG2vFL9SrrJUz76FJy9xGEr7FN
transaction
336be4e4bf83902df2987846476e0453dfae0f37b91cebf0eca97c4b95027f56
spent
true